In this follow-up to our conversation on divorce and healing, Dr. Meg Meeker sits down with therapist and integrative healer Dawn Wiggins to talk about what it really takes to recover from any kind of trauma — whether it’s divorce, loss, or years of emotional stress.
Wiggins explains how trauma shapes our nervous system, thoughts, and relationships — and how real healing happens when we reconnect body, mind, and spirit. Together, they unpack practical ways to calm the body, release old pain, and create safety from the inside out.

About Dawn Wiggins
Dawn Wiggins is a licensed therapist, homeopath, and integrative healer who helps people recover from trauma and life transitions. She’s the creator of A Different “D” Word, a year-long healing program, and host of the podcast Dear Divorce Diary, where she guides listeners toward emotional safety, balance, and self-trust.
